Chimney in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a chimney’s condition to identify potential issues that could affect safety and performance. During an inspection, professionals examine the interior and exterior of the chimney, checking for signs of damage, blockages, creosote buildup, and structural problems. They may utilize specialized tools such as cameras to gain a detailed view of the chimney’s interior, ensuring that any hidden issues are detected early. This process helps property owners maintain a safe and efficient fireplace or heating system by addressing problems before they develop into more serious concerns.
One of the primary benefits of chimney inspections is the early detection of issues that can lead to fire hazards or indoor air quality problems. Blockages caused by debris, bird nests, or creosote buildup can restrict airflow and increase the risk of chimney fires. Cracks or deterioration in the chimney structure can lead to leaks or allow dangerous gases like carbon monoxide to escape into living spaces. Regular inspections help identify these problems, enabling timely repairs that can prevent costly damage and ensure the safe operation of heating appliances.

Inspection Cost - The typical cost for a chimney inspection 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the property's size and inspection complexity. For example, a standard inspection in Pleasanton, CA, might be around $150. Costs can vary based on location and service provider.
Basic Inspection Fees - Basic chimney inspections generally fall between $100 and $200. This includes visual checks and minor assessments, with prices influenced by chimney type and accessibility. Expect to pay around $125 in many cases.
Comprehensive Inspection Expenses - A thorough, detailed inspection may cost between $200 and $400, especially if additional services like video scans are included. Prices depend on the extent of inspection needed and local market rates.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as cleaning or repairs are billed separately, often adding $150 to $500 or more. These costs vary based on the scope of work and the local service providers in Pleasanton, CA.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is included in a chimney inspection service? A chimney inspection typically involves examining the chimney structure, checking for creosote buildup, inspecting the flue liner, and assessing the overall condition of the chimney system.
How often should I have my chimney inspected? It is recommended to have a chimney inspected at least once a year, especially if it is used frequently or shows signs of wear.
What are the benefits of a professional chimney inspection? A professional inspection can identify potential hazards, prevent chimney fires, and ensure the safe operation of the chimney system.
What signs indicate I need a chimney inspection? Signs include smoke escaping into the home, a strong odor, soot or creosote buildup, or visible damage to the chimney exterior.
